May 21, 2012 11:59 AMI did something similar to this for my bunco group by using pound cake. I froze it and cut it into cubes. Took a large tip on a pipping bag and filled them with raspberry jam. Dipped them into white chocolate I colored pink and added raspberry flavoring. Used mini chips to make the number dots. To display them, I went to dollar store and got colorful dice. Filled clear $1 vases with dice. Everyone loved them!
